Home Health Aide Jobs in South Carolina
A Home Health Aide (HHA) plays a pivotal role in the nursing industry by providing personal care to patients who require assistance with daily tasks within their homes. HHAs often work with the elderly, the chronically ill, and those recovering from injury or surgery who may be unable to care for themselves. They assist with activities such as bathing, dressing, meal preparation, medication management and sometimes, transportation to medical appointments. They also monitor patients' vital signs, illness symptoms, and physical and emotional well-being, providing a critical link between the patient and the healthcare team.
Key skills that a Home Health Aide should possess include compassion, patience, good communication and interpersonal skills, physical stamina, and a strong sense of responsibility. Additionally, they must be trained in basic emergency response and understanding of safety and sanitation procedures. Certification requirements may differ by location, but most HHAs should have a high school diploma, complete a state approved training program and pass a competency examination. Prior to becoming a Home Health Aide, one might have held positions such as a personal care aide, nursing assistant, or a caregiver, roles that involve direct care provision and allow for the accumulation of relevant experience.
